Runbook: StormRelay fan-out. When a weather alert is published, StormRelay fans it out to regional notifier queues within 30 seconds. If the fan-out stalls, check the dispatcher pods first; a restart clears most backlogs. For a full redeploy, the dispatcher reads its configuration from the .env file mounted at startup, including queue hosts, region list, and retry windows. Those values are already committed. The broker credential is not committed and must be added manually, so append it on the line below.

vault entry, yahif-yajep: COURIER_KEY29=b802bdf8034096b65a51c6ba5abe2

Support team: the Verdanta controller's humidity probes drift roughly 2% per month in high-condensation bays, which is why customers report "stuck" readings. Before escalating, check DRIFT_COMP_ENABLED in the site env file — when true, the firmware applies a rolling recalibration every six hours and drift complaints usually resolve within a day. Never toggle it mid-cycle; wait for the maintenance window. The controller pulls calibration curves from the Verdanta cloud, authenticated by the key set on the next line.

sealed setting: ARCHIVE_KEY3=8d0

Capacity note for the Bramblewick export retry queue. Failed exports are requeued with exponential backoff, and the queue depth is our main capacity signal: sustained depth above the high-water mark means downstream Pellis storage is saturated, not that we need more workers. As the new contractor, please don't raise worker counts without checking storage latency first — it usually makes things worse. Retry timing, backoff caps, and the high-water threshold are all driven by the constants shown below.

limits module of yagef-bajog:
TIERS = {
    "druael": 370,
    "tamix": 286,
    "pelius": 541,
    "pelael": 78,
    "pelox": 47,
    "ralath": 533,
    "drumir": 801,
}

Minutes — Management Meeting, Supplier Contract Renewal

Attendees: branch managers, operations lead. The Tarnwell Supply contract renews for two years with a 3% cost reduction and revised delivery windows. Branch managers to confirm stock schedules by month-end. Disputes from the Hollis Bay branch were resolved. Background on the renewal strategy is recorded in the note below.

board note of kageg-bahof: The renewal with Holwynax Holdings closes at $2 million a year, 5 percent below the last contract. Project Ulaath slips by two quarters because of the supplier delay.